Data Snapshot: ZIP 38259 (Trimble, TN)

U.S. Treasury FIO ZIP-level observations put the average homeowners insurance premium in ZIP 38259 (Trimble, TN) at $1,924 per year for 2022 across approximately 11 reported policies. That is 8% above the national average of $1,776 per year, placing this ZIP in the 72nd percentile nationally. The Tennessee statewide average is $1,728 per year; this ZIP sits 11% above that figure, ranking #89 of 552 tracked ZIPs in Tennessee by premium. The closest-priced peer within Tennessee is Elmwood (ZIP 38560) at $1,920, essentially matching this ZIP's rate.

With a loss ratio of 32.1%, insurers retained a working margin after claims in ZIP 38259. Claim frequency, the share of policies with at least one claim, is 7.41%, and the average claim severity (amount paid per claim) is $8,342. Nonrenewal, insurers declining to extend coverage at policy expiration, occurs at 3.70% in this ZIP, a rise of 122.2% over the past five years; rising nonrenewal often signals insurer retreat from high-risk markets.

Premium data spanning 5 years shows ZIP 38259 costs have risen 11.8% since 2018, from a low of $1,687 to a high of $1,924, an annualized rate of +2.8% per year.

How to read these numbers

The figures on this page come from the U.S. Treasury Federal Insurance Office, which collects homeowners insurance premium and claims data directly from the largest property insurers in the country. Because the data is aggregated at the ZIP-code level and averaged across many policies, it describes the typical cost in an area rather than a quote for any single home. Two houses on the same street can pay very different premiums depending on their age, construction type, roof condition, prior claims, and the specific coverage limits and deductibles the homeowner selects. The loss ratio shows how much of every premium dollar insurers paid back out as claims; a ratio above one means carriers lost money locally, which often precedes rate increases or carrier exits. Rising nonrenewal and claim frequency reveal how stressed the local market has become. Use these figures to gauge the direction and scale of costs in your area, then request quotes from several licensed carriers before buying or renewing a policy. FIO data aggregates voluntary reporting from the 40 largest homeowners insurers, covering roughly 80% of the U.S. market, so figures represent market averages rather than individual policy quotes; your own premium will vary with dwelling value, deductible, coverage limits, construction type, and insurer-specific underwriting.
